微信小程序的开发工具是一款名为“微信web开发者工具”的基于Electron开发的集成开发环境(IDE),它主要支持三大平台:Windows、macOS和Linux。该工具提供了一个界面友好、操作简单的开发环境,可以使开发者快速地创建并开发小程序。本文将从原理、功能和使用等方面详细介绍西安微信小程序里的开发工具。
一、原理
微信小程序的开发工具是基于微信开发的一款IDE工具。它是一个桥梁,连接开发者和微信小程序服务。开发者可以通过该工具创建和管理小程序、开发和调试代码、构建和发布小程序等。该工具使用了很多技术,其中最重要的是Web技术和本地的File I/O功能。
微信小程序开发工具利用Web技术实现了小程序的前端开发,包括HTML、CSS和JavaScript等。它还提供了一系列的API接口,开发者可以调用这些API实现小程序的不同功能。同时,该工具还新增了一些预处理器,如ES6、Sass、Less和Typescript等,开发者可以使用这些预处理器提高开发效率。
二、功能
1. 创建和管理小程序:开发工具的主要功能是帮助开发者创建和管理小程序,包括新建小程序、导入小程序、打开小程序和发布小程序等。当用户新建或打开一个小程序时,开发工具会自动创建本地文件夹并下载小程序的代码和资源。用户只需在开发工具中编辑代码和资源,进行调试后,即可使用开发工具上传并发布小程序。
2. 编辑、调试代码:开发工具提供了完善的代码编辑和调试功能,包括代码高亮、代码提示、代码自动补全、代码格式化、代码跳转、代码重构、及时错误提示等。在代码调试方面,开发工具提供了实时预览、元素查看器、控制台和网络工具等。
3. 构建和发布小程序:构建和发布小程序是开发工具的另一项重要功能。开发者可以在开发工具中使用微信插件进行构建和打包小程序,也可以直接使用微信开发者工具上传并发布小程序。开发工具提供了一个全面的管理平台,让开发人员能够有效地控制和管理小程序的各个方面。
三、使用
1. 下载和安装开发工具:微信开发工具可以在微信官方网站上进行下载,该工具支持Windows、macOS和Linux等多个平台。用户可以根据自己的系统要求下载并安装适合自己的版本。
2. 创建和打开小程序:创建小程序可以通过开发工具的“新建”功能进行操作,用户只需输入小程序名称和AppID,即可创建小程序并下载代码和资源。打开小程序可以通过开发工具的“打开小程序”功能实现,用户只需输入小程序的AppID即可。
3. 编辑、调试代码:编写小程序需要使用开发工具中的代码编辑器。用户可以在代码编辑器中输入和修改代码,运行并测试代码。此外,开发者还可以使用开发工具的调试工具进行测试和检查代码的错误和BUG。
4. 构建和发布小程序:在完成代码编写和测试后,开发者需要使用工具中的构建和打包功能进行小程序的构建。同时,该工具还提供了小程序的发布功能,支持上传和发布小程序到微信平台。
总之,微信小程序开发者工具是一个非常强大的开发环境,它提供了完善的代码编辑和调试功能、丰富的API接口、可靠的构建和发布功能以及全面的小程序管理平台。如果你想要学习和开发微信小程序,这个工具将会是你不可或缺的伙伴。